如何高效、安全、可靠地存储与处理这些数据,成为了所有组织机构面临的重大挑战
在这一背景下,磁盘阵列与服务器作为数据存储与处理的两大核心组件,其重要性日益凸显
本文将深入探讨磁盘阵列与服务器的技术原理、协同工作机制以及在现代信息系统中的关键作用,旨在为读者揭示这两者如何携手构建高效数据存储与处理体系的奥秘
一、磁盘阵列:数据存储的坚固防线 磁盘阵列,简称RAID(Redundant Arrays of Independent Disks),是一种通过物理上多个硬盘的组合来提供高性能、高可用性和高扩展性的数据存储解决方案
RAID技术的核心在于通过特定的算法将数据分散存储于多个硬盘上,同时实现数据的冗余备份,以提高数据的可靠性和访问速度
1.RAID级别与特性 -RAID 0:无冗余,但性能最高,通过将数据分割存储于多个磁盘上实现并行读写,适用于对速度要求极高但对数据安全要求不高的场景
-RAID 1:镜像模式,数据在两个磁盘上完全复制,提供最高的数据安全性,但成本较高,空间利用率仅50%
-RAID 5:分布式奇偶校验,至少需三块硬盘,提供数据冗余且性能较好,空间利用率较高,是平衡性能与成本的优选
-RAID 6:相比RAID 5增加第二个独立奇偶校验,能容忍两块硬盘同时故障,适用于对数据安全性要求极高的环境
-RAID 10(RAID 1+0):结合RAID1和RAID 0的优势,先镜像后条带化,提供最高级别的性能和可靠性,但成本也最高
2.磁盘阵列的优势 -高性能:通过并行处理,显著提高数据读写速度
-高可靠性:通过冗余设计,确保数据在硬盘故障时不会丢失
-高扩展性:易于添加新的硬盘以扩展存储容量
二、服务器:数据处理的中枢神经 服务器,作为网络环境中的核心设备,负责处理客户端的请求、执行应用程序、存储和传输数据
根据功能和应用场景的不同,服务器可分为多种类型,如Web服务器、数据库服务器、文件服务器、应用服务器等
服务器的性能直接影响整个信息系统的运行效率和用户体验
1.服务器的关键组件 -处理器(CPU):服务器的计算核心,决定了数据处理的速度和效率
-内存(RAM):临时存储数据的区域,快速访问数据,加速程序运行
-存储设备:包括硬盘(HDD)、固态硬盘(SSD)以及磁盘阵列,用于长期存储数据
-网络接口卡(NIC):负责服务器与外部网络的通信
-电源供应单元(PSU):确保服务器稳定运行的关键
2.服务器的性能评估 -处理能力:CPU型号、核心数、主频等直接影响服务器的计算性能
-内存大小:越大的内存意味着能同时处理更多的任务和数据
-I/O性能:存储设备的读写速度、网络带宽等,影响数据交换的效率
-可扩展性:是否支持硬件升级,能否适应未来业务增长的需求
三、磁盘阵列与服务器的协同工作:构建高效数据存储与处理体系 磁盘阵列与服务器不是孤立存在的,它们通过协同工作,共同支撑起一个高效、安全、可扩展的数据存储与处理体系
1.数据存储与访问优化 服务器通过高速网络接口与磁盘阵列相连,利用RAID技术提供的并行读写能力,实现数据的快速存取
特别是在处理大数据量、高并发访问的场景下,磁盘阵列能够显著减轻服务器的I/O负担,提升整体系统的响应速度和吞吐量
2.数据保护与容灾备份 磁盘阵列的冗余设计,如RAID 5、RAID 6等,为数据提供了额外的保护层
即使部分硬盘发生故障,也能迅速恢复数据,确保业务连续性
同时,结合服务器的备份策略,如定期快照、异地备份等,进一步增强了数据的容灾能力
3.资源动态分配与负载均衡 现代服务器往往具备虚拟化技术,能够根据业务需求动态分配CPU、内存等资源
结合磁盘阵列的高扩展性,可以灵活调整存储容量,实现资源的优化配置
此外,通过负载均衡技术,将请求分散到多台服务器上处理,有效避免单点故障,提升系统整体的稳定性和可用性
4.智能管理与运维 随着技术的发展,磁盘阵列和服务器都配备了强大的管理软件,如RAID控制器的管理界面、服务器的BIOS/UEFI设置、操作系统层面的存储管理工具等
这些工具不仅简化了设备的配置和维护,还提供了性能监控、故障预警、自动化修复等功能,大大降低了运维成本,提高了管理效率
四、结语:面向未来的数据存储与处理挑战 随着云计算、大数据、人工智能等新兴技术的兴起,数据呈现出爆炸式增长的趋势,对存储和处理能力提出了更高要求
磁盘阵列与服务器作为数据存储与处理的核心基石,正不断进化以适应这些挑战
从SAS/SATA到NVMe SSD的存储介质升级,从单节点服务器到云计算集群的架构变革,每一步都推动着信息技术向更高效、更智能的方向发展
未来,随着技术的持续创新,磁盘阵列与服务器将更加紧密地融合,形成更加智能化、自动化的数据存储与处理体系
无论是面对海量数据的实时分析,还是复杂应用的快速部署,这一体系都将为各行各业提供强有力的支撑,助力数字经济的蓬勃发展
因此,深入理解和掌握磁盘阵列与服务器的技术原理及其协同工作机制,对于构建高效、安全、可扩展的信息系统具有至关重要的意义